			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h3>What are all inclusive cruise deals and how do they work?</h3>
<p>All Inclusive deals do exactly what the description says. Essentially it means that the price that you initially pay for your vacation covers everything that you will need, so that’s not only the room accommodation but all the food and drinks through-out the voyage. It may include extra facilities on board ship, however there may be some downsides to an all inclusive package that you should be aware of before you make your booking, like facilities that you might not want to use therefore making the cruise choice less appealing.</p>
<p>Firstly make sure that you read about all the details of the holiday, you will be provided these by your tour operator. In here it will describe to you exactly what is included and what is not. One thing to note is that in general when they say “all drinks are included”, this just means that you can go to the restaurants whenever you like and order tea, coffee or soft drinks. Usually this does not include alcoholic drinks like beer or spirits. As another quick point, on some ships, the coffee or soft drinks may not necessarily be free if you get them from the bars on board so you should check this before you order any.</p>
<p>It has to be said that an all inclusive package cruise is a good choice as long as you do your due diligence and make sure what’s included. Be careful though with some advertisements, some companies will offer you what looks like a great all inclusive prices, but upon closer inspection you may find out that some things are optional. Not knowing this until you board ship could be a costly mistake so make sure you check first.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h2><span style="text-decoration: underline;"><strong>Top tips for a last minute European cruise</strong></span></h2>
<p>Before telling the best to best way to get a last minute deal, it can help to first understand a few things about why last minute deals exist and what they entail.</p>
<p>Just because a cruise is last minute doesn&#8217;t mean there is something wrong with it! On the contrary 		a last minute deal has the potential to be a fantastic European holiday with lots of features.</p>
<p>These last minute cruises tend to come about because they are very close to the time when the 		cruise will be sailing and the cruise companies will be trying to fill up all the remaining  berths on the ship so they can maximise their profits. Of course this means that there is also 	plenty of chances for you to get yourself a cut price deal. Other reasons might inlude, end of season cruise timetables which can affect bookings. It is also possible that the ships may 	not be as popular, perhaps is older and has less facilities than a newer craft. For this reason is is extremely important that you choose a well known or trustworthy travel company to book through so you understand what you are getting for your money.</p>
